While Bandai Namco had hoped to surprise fans with the announcement of some new exciting games, it appears those plans have been botched by a security vulnerability on its site. Through this vulnerability, someone was able to gain access to the Bandai Namco site and discover what the publisher has planned for E3 2019, including the name of From Software’s new game with George RR Martin, a Ni No Kuni Remaster, and a new entry in the Tales franchise.

While details on the From Software game is relatively slim, the new Tales game seems to be further along. According to a press release, the game will be called Tales of Arise and it will update the series with modern combat and high fidelity visuals but with classic Tales gameplay mixed in.

To help better illustrate the game’s visuals, Bandai Namco’s site included a few Tales of Arise screenshots mainly focused on the environment and combat. Both screenshots are undeniably from the Tales lineage but the fidelity is much higher than the last game to release in the series, Tales of Berseria.

The press release also gives an idea of the game’s story, which features a classic JRPG conflict between an affluent city in the sky and the city below:

Challenge the Fate That Binds You

On the planet Dahna, reverence has always been given to Rena, the planet in the sky, as a land of the righteous and divine. Stories handed down for generations became truth and masked reality for the people of Dahna. For 300 years, Rena has ruled over Dahna, pillaging the planet of its resources and stripping people of their dignity and freedom. Our tale begins with two people, born on different worlds, each looking to change their fate and create a new future.

Featuring a new cast of characters, updated combat, and classic Tales of gameplay mechanics, experience the next chapter in the world-famous Tale of series, Tales of Arise.

Although this leak spoiled the initial reveal for Bandai Namco, there is likely more to be shown of and said about Tales of Arise in the coming days. It’s possible that the game might make an appearance during Microsoft’s E3 2019 press conference but if not Bandai Namco should unveil a new trailer as the show floor opens on Tuesday, potentially earlier.

However, Elden Ring, the name game from From Software and A Song of Ice and Fire (the Game of Thrones writer) author George RR Martin, is most assuredly going to appear on Microsoft’s stage. The game has been rumored for some time now and details have been leaking from various sources left and right. Now fans have something official to consider in preparation for a larger reveal this coming week.
